Searched refs:NativeConverter (Results 1 - 7 of 7) sorted by relevance

/libcore/luni/src/main/java/java/nio/charset/
H A DCharsetICU.java12 import libcore.icu.NativeConverter;
36 return NativeConverter.contains(this.name(), cs.name());
H A DCharsetDecoderICU.java20 import libcore.icu.NativeConverter;
55 address = NativeConverter.openConverter(icuCanonicalName);
56 float averageCharsPerByte = NativeConverter.getAveCharsPerByte(address);
63 NativeConverter.closeConverter(address);
71 NativeConverter.registerConverter(this, converterHandle);
87 NativeConverter.setCallbackDecode(converterHandle, this);
91 NativeConverter.resetByteToChar(converterHandle);
113 int error = NativeConverter.decode(converterHandle, input, inEnd, output, outEnd, data, true);
139 int error = NativeConverter.decode(converterHandle, input, inEnd, output, outEnd, data, false);
H A DCharsetEncoderICU.java22 import libcore.icu.NativeConverter;
71 address = NativeConverter.openConverter(icuCanonicalName);
72 float averageBytesPerChar = NativeConverter.getAveBytesPerChar(address);
73 float maxBytesPerChar = NativeConverter.getMaxBytesPerChar(address);
80 NativeConverter.closeConverter(address);
92 return NativeConverter.getSubstitutionBytes(address);
99 NativeConverter.registerConverter(this, converterHandle);
116 NativeConverter.setCallbackEncode(converterHandle, this);
120 NativeConverter.resetCharToByte(converterHandle);
142 int error = NativeConverter
[all...]
/libcore/luni/src/main/native/
H A Dlibcore_icu_NativeConverter.cpp16 #define LOG_TAG "NativeConverter"
629 NATIVE_METHOD(NativeConverter, charsetForName, "(Ljava/lang/String;)Ljava/nio/charset/Charset;"),
630 NATIVE_METHOD(NativeConverter, closeConverter, "(J)V"),
631 NATIVE_METHOD(NativeConverter, contains, "(Ljava/lang/String;Ljava/lang/String;)Z"),
632 NATIVE_METHOD(NativeConverter, decode, "(J[BI[CI[IZ)I"),
633 NATIVE_METHOD(NativeConverter, encode, "(J[CI[BI[IZ)I"),
634 NATIVE_METHOD(NativeConverter, getAvailableCharsetNames, "()[Ljava/lang/String;"),
635 NATIVE_METHOD(NativeConverter, getAveBytesPerChar, "(J)F"),
636 NATIVE_METHOD(NativeConverter, getAveCharsPerByte, "(J)F"),
637 NATIVE_METHOD(NativeConverter, getMaxBytesPerCha
[all...]
/libcore/luni/src/main/java/libcore/icu/
H A DNativeConverter.java19 public final class NativeConverter { class
21 NativeConverter.class.getClassLoader(), getNativeFinalizer(), getNativeSize());
51 // Translates from Java's enum to the magic numbers #defined in "NativeConverter.cpp".
/libcore/ojluni/src/main/java/java/nio/charset/
H A DCharset.java30 import libcore.icu.NativeConverter;
516 if ((cs = NativeConverter.charsetForName(charsetName)) != null ||
636 for (String charsetName : NativeConverter.getAvailableCharsetNames()) {
637 Charset charset = NativeConverter.charsetForName(charsetName);
/libcore/
H A Dnon_openjdk_java_files.mk364 luni/src/main/java/libcore/icu/NativeConverter.java \

Completed in 147 milliseconds